Energy Futures: Oil, Gas, and Renewable Markets

Energy futures play a significant role in the global financial market, allowing investors to speculate on the future price of oil, gas, and renewable energy sources. These contracts help participants manage risk associated with price fluctuations. Different factors impact energy futures, including supply and demand dynamics, geopolitical events, and technological advancements. For instance, a sudden conflict in an oil-rich region could drive prices up, while advancements in renewable technologies might lower risks associated with traditional energy investments. The crude oil market is particularly noteworthy due to its size and global influence. Investors need robust strategies to navigate these uncertainties effectively. Engaging in energy futures trading requires understanding various indicators. Key indicators include inventory levels, production rates, and consumption patterns that signal market movements. Traders use a combination of technical and fundamental analysis to make informed decisions. Additionally, regulations governing the market are essential. Compliance with these regulations ensures fair trading practices and helps maintain stability across the board. When one discusses oil futures, it is vital to highlight different types, such as Brent and WTI crude. Brent crude oil serves as a global benchmark, traded primarily in Europe, while West Texas Intermediate (WTI) is the primary benchmark in the United States. Each has varying prices influenced by numerous aspects. For instance, geopolitical tensions often affect the Brent price more due to its global reach. Examining historical price trends garners insights into market behavior over time. These benchmarks also determine pricing for various refined products like gasoline and diesel. Furthermore, the seasonal demand plays a critical role; for instance, summer months often see increased demand due to travel and holiday activities. Therefore, traders monitor patterns closely, allowing them to hedge or speculate accordingly. Moreover, traders utilize tools such as futures contracts to mitigate risks associated with price volatility. Additionally, the emergence of exchange-traded funds (ETFs) linked to oil futures has simplified trading access for retail investors. This evolution includes investing indirectly through funds that hold oil futures contracts, providing diversified exposure to the sector. Such strategies cater to varying risk appetites, shaping investment behaviors among individuals and institutions alike.

The Natural Gas Market

Natural gas futures represent another significant segment within energy futures, offering unique opportunities and challenges. Short-term and long-term predictions in this market can greatly differ due to factors such as weather conditions, seasonal demand, and extraction technologies. During colder months, demand surges as people rely on gas for heating, causing prices to fluctuate significantly. Similarly, an exceptionally mild winter can lead to decreased demand, pushing prices down. These price irregularities force traders to keep a close eye on weather forecasts and production data. Additionally, liquefied natural gas (LNG) has emerged as a key player in international markets, influencing domestic prices. The interconnectedness of global markets means that shifts in one region can impact natural gas futures in another. With increasing environmental regulations, natural gas is often considered a transitional fuel toward cleaner energy, fostering investments into extraction technologies. Furthermore, traders analyze various reports, such as the Energy Information Administration (EIA) reports, which provide crucial data on inventory levels and production rates. These insights help stakeholders make strategic decisions, ensuring they can navigate this fluctuating market effectively and capitalize on emerging trends.

Renewable energy futures are gaining significant popularity, mirroring the global shift towards sustainability. Instruments associated with solar and wind energy have gained traction, providing additional diversification opportunities. Investors are increasingly eyeing solar farms and wind projects as potential growth areas. However, this emerging market presents volatility challenges and varying regulatory landscapes across regions. As governments introduce incentives and frameworks for renewable energy, the futures tied to these segments can experience enhancements in liquidity and trading volumes. The regulatory frameworks often determine how investors engage with these futures. Moreover, technological advancements in energy storage and grid integration are vital for the reliability of renewables. This impacts investment decisions; stakeholders need to understand these technological challenges to prevent costly missteps. Additionally, as renewables increasingly get integrated into traditional energy portfolios, investors are urged to consider ESG factors when making decisions. This involves assessing environmental, social, and governance criteria to align investments with broader sustainable goals. As awareness and interest in renewable energy grow, futures can serve as effective instruments for investors looking to hedge against volatility and embrace the transition to a greener economy.

Understanding futures pricing structures is another vital component for energy market participants. Futures contracts typically trade at a premium or discount to their underlying asset’s spot price, depending on supply-demand dynamics and market sentiment. These price differences reveal critical insights into market expectations for the future. For instance, a significant contango situation can indicate higher future prices, while backwardation suggests supply scarcity. Traders must navigate these structures to optimize their investment strategies effectively. Furthermore, monitoring open interest levels assists market participants in gauging market participation and liquidity. High open interest typically signifies robust trading activity, while decreasing open interest can indicate a reduction in market interest. Understanding these metrics creates options for strategic entry and exit points.
